What is Shipping Container Architecture?
Shipping container architecture includes making use of repurposed shipping containers as structure blocks for structures. Initially used for shipping items, these containers are now recognized for their structural stability, durability, and modular nature. Architects and builders have embraced this trend, creating innovative styles that make efficient use of area and resources.
Tables: Key Characteristics of Shipping ContainersCharacteristicDescriptionProductMade from corten steel, offering resilience and resistance to rust and weather condition elements.SizeStandard containers are typically 20 to 40 feet long, 8 feet wide, and 8.5 feet high, using modular versatility.CostUsually lower construction and material costs compared to standard structure techniques.Eco-FriendlinessUtilizing repurposed products decreases waste and the carbon footprint associated with traditional construction.FlexibilityCan be stacked, arranged, and modified to produce various designs, from single-family homes to multi-story commercial structures.Benefits of Shipping Container Architecture1. Sustainability
Among the most engaging factors to consider shipping container architecture is its sustainability factor. By repurposing containers that would otherwise rust away in a lawn, designers can considerably minimize waste and promote environment-friendly structure practices.

4. Speed of Construction
Shipping container structures can be assembled much faster than traditional building and constructions. The modular nature of containers permits quick onsite assembly, allowing faster tenancy for property and industrial tasks.
5. Flexibility and Modularity
The modular design of shipping containers enables designers and home builders to produce custom layouts and configurations. Containers can be quickly stacked and arranged to form intricate styles matched to numerous needs-- property, business, or mixed-use.

FAQ About Shipping Container ArchitectureQ1: Are shipping container homes safe?
Yes, shipping container homes are developed to be structurally sound and are constructed to hold up against extreme conditions. However, proper insulation and ventilation need to be considered to make sure comfort.

Q3: How long do shipping container homes last?
With correct upkeep and care, shipping container homes can last for decades. The corten steel used in containers is corrosion-resistant, guaranteeing longevity.
Q4: Are shipping container homes energy-efficient?
Yes, shipping container homes can be designed to be energy-efficient by incorporating proper insulation, solar panels, and energy-efficient home appliances.
Q5: Can shipping containers be modified for different environments?
Absolutely! Containers can be insulated and geared up with heating and cooling systems to make them appropriate for any climate.
